Πρώτη κρυπτογραφία

Contents

Προέλευση της κρυπτογραφίας

Εάν χρησιμοποιείτε έναν απλό κρυπτογράφημα υποκατάστασης, όπως η ανάλυση συχνότητας, δεν σπάει τον κώδικα, ένας εισβολέας θα μπορούσε να εκτελέσει μια επίθεση βίαιης δύναμης. Αυτό το είδος επίθεσης συνεπάγεται τη δοκιμή κάθε πιθανής μετατόπισης σε ένα μικρό απόσπασμα του μηνύματος. Έτσι, εάν το μήνυμα είναι γραμμένο στα αγγλικά, αυτό θα απαιτούσε μέγιστο 26 δοκιμές, αφού υπάρχουν 26 γράμματα στο αγγλικό αλφάβητο. Ενώ αυτό δεν είναι μια ιδιαίτερα εξελιγμένη επίθεση, είναι αποτελεσματική.

Η ιστορία της κρυπτογραφίας: ιστορία

Η κρυπτογραφία είναι η επιστήμη των μυστικών. Κυριολεκτικά σημαίνει «κρυμμένη γραφή», η κρυπτογραφία είναι μια μέθοδος απόκρυψης και προστασίας πληροφοριών χρησιμοποιώντας έναν κώδικα ή κρυπτογράφημα, μόνο αποκρυπτογραφημένη από τον προοριζόμενο παραλήπτη του. Σήμερα, η σύγχρονη κρυπτογραφία είναι απαραίτητη για το ασφαλές διαδίκτυο, την εταιρική ασφάλεια στον κυβερνοχώρο και την τεχνολογία blockchain. Ωστόσο, η πρώτη χρήση των κρυπτογράφων χρονολογείται από περίπου 100 π.Χ.

Σε αυτή τη σειρά τριών μερών, θα εξερευνήσουμε την ιστορία της κρυπτογραφίας πριν από τον 20ο αιώνα, τον 20ό αιώνα, και τη σύγχρονη ημέρα.

Ιστορική κρυπτογραφία

Καίσαρα

Το “Caesar Box”, ή “Caesar Cipher”, είναι ένας από τους πρώτους γνωστούς κρυπτογράφους. Αναπτύχθηκε περίπου 100 π.Χ., χρησιμοποιήθηκε από τον Julius Caesar για να στείλει μυστικά μηνύματα στους στρατηγούς του στον τομέα. Σε περίπτωση παρακολούθησης ενός από τα μηνύματά του, ο αντίπαλός του δεν μπορούσε να τα διαβάσει. Αυτό προφανώς του έδωσε ένα μεγάλο στρατηγικό πλεονέκτημα. Λοιπόν, ποιος ήταν ο κώδικας?

Ο Καίσαρας μετατόπισε κάθε γράμμα του μηνύματός του τρία γράμματα προς τα δεξιά για να παράγει αυτό που θα μπορούσε να ονομαστεί το κρυπτογράφημα. Το κρυπτογράφημα είναι αυτό που θα έβλεπε ο εχθρός αντί του αληθινού μηνύματος. Έτσι, για παράδειγμα, εάν τα μηνύματα του Caesar γράφτηκαν στο αγγλικό αλφάβητο, κάθε γράμμα “a” στο μήνυμα θα γίνει “d”, το “b” θα γίνει “e” και το “x’s” γίνονται “Α.”Αυτός ο τύπος κρυπτογράφησης ονομάζεται κατάλληλα” κρυπτογράφημα αλλαγής ταχυτήτων.«

Ο μαγικός αριθμός του Caesar ήταν τρεις, ωστόσο, μια σύγχρονη χρήση του Caesar Cipher είναι ένας κώδικας που ονομάζεται “ROT13.”ROT13, σύντομη για” Περιστρέφοντας με 13 θέσεις “, μετατοπίζει κάθε γράμμα του αγγλικού αλφαβήτου 13 χώρους. Χρησιμοποιείται συχνά σε ηλεκτρονικά φόρουμ για να κρύψει πληροφορίες όπως κινηματογραφικές και τηλεοπτικές spoilers, λύσεις σε παζλ ή παιχνίδια ή προσβλητικό υλικό. Ο κώδικας είναι εύκολα διάσημος, ωστόσο, κρύβει τις πληροφορίες από τη γρήγορη ματιά.

Ghostvolt Solo

Rock Solid αρχείου κρυπτογράφηση για όλους

Προστατέψτε την κλοπή δεδομένων και κλειδώστε εύκολα οποιοδήποτε αρχείο με αυτοματοποιημένη κρυπτογράφηση, οργανώστε με ετικέτα αρχείων και μοιραστείτε με ασφάλεια τα αρχεία σας με οποιονδήποτε.

Ghostvolt Solo Free Trial

Cryptanalysis: Breaking a Caesar Box

Το πιο δύσκολο μέρος της σπασίματος ενός κουτιού Caesar είναι να υπολογίσει τη γλώσσα του μηνύματος που κωδικοποιεί. Μόλις ο κώδικας Cracker το υπολογίσει, εξετάζονται δύο σενάρια. Είτε ο “επιτιθέμενος” χρησιμοποιεί μια τεχνική όπως η ανάλυση συχνότητας, είτε χρησιμοποιούν αυτό που αναφέρεται ως επίθεση βίαιης δύναμης.

  Fuga de DNS expressvpn

Σε πρώτη φάση, ο επιτιθέμενος γνωρίζει ότι ορισμένα γράμματα χρησιμοποιούνται πιο συχνά από άλλα. Για παράδειγμα, τα a, e, o και t είναι τα πιο συχνά χρησιμοποιούμενα γράμματα, ενώ τα q, x και z είναι τα λιγότερο. Οι σχετικές συχνότητες κάθε γράμματος στην αγγλική γλώσσα εμφανίζονται στο παρακάτω γράφημα.

Γραφικό γράφημα που δείχνει τη σχετική συχνότητα κάθε γράμματος στην αγγλική γλώσσα

Εάν χρησιμοποιείτε έναν απλό κρυπτογράφημα υποκατάστασης, όπως η ανάλυση συχνότητας, δεν σπάει τον κώδικα, ένας εισβολέας θα μπορούσε να εκτελέσει μια επίθεση βίαιης δύναμης. Αυτό το είδος επίθεσης συνεπάγεται τη δοκιμή κάθε πιθανής μετατόπισης σε ένα μικρό απόσπασμα του μηνύματος. Έτσι, εάν το μήνυμα είναι γραμμένο στα αγγλικά, αυτό θα απαιτούσε μέγιστο 26 δοκιμές, αφού υπάρχουν 26 γράμματα στο αγγλικό αλφάβητο. Ενώ αυτό δεν είναι μια ιδιαίτερα εξελιγμένη επίθεση, είναι αποτελεσματική.

Ο κρυπτογράφος Vigenère

Ο κρυπτογραφικός κρυπτογράφος Vigenère, που δημιουργήθηκε τον 16ο αιώνα, χρησιμοποιεί ένα στοιχείο που δεν βρίσκεται σε έναν κρυπτογραφικό Caesar: Ένα μυστικό κλειδί. Ο δημιουργός του κώδικα επιλέγει οποιαδήποτε λέξη ή συνδυασμό γραμμάτων τυχαία για να είναι το κλειδί, για παράδειγμα, “Dog.”Η επιλεγμένη λέξη -κλειδί θα ταιριάζει στη συνέχεια με το μήνυμα PlainText που θέλετε να κρυπτογραφήσετε, για παράδειγμα,” Attack.”Μπορείτε να δείτε ότι η λέξη -κλειδί” σκύλος “είναι μικρότερη από τη λέξη” επίθεση “με τρία γράμματα. Σε αυτή την περίπτωση, επαναλάβετε το κλειδί σας μέχρι να ταιριάζει με τον αριθμό των γραμμάτων στο μήνυμα σας. Σε αυτή την περίπτωση, θα είχατε τότε “Dogdog.«

Τώρα, θα μπορείτε να δημιουργήσετε το κρυπτογράφημα. Για να το κάνετε αυτό, θα πρέπει να χρησιμοποιήσετε το παρακάτω διάγραμμα.

Μια μήτρα επιστολών που εξηγεί την έννοια πίσω από τη βάση του κρυπτογράφου Vigenère

Οι στήλες είναι τα γράμματα του μυστικού κλειδιού, ενώ οι σειρές είναι τα γράμματα του μηνύματος του κείμενο. Έτσι, για το παράδειγμά μας, το πρώτο γράμμα του κλειδιού μας είναι “D”, ενώ το πρώτο γράμμα της λέξης του κείμενο είναι “a.”Έτσι, βρείτε πού τέμνονται στο γράφημα και θα βρείτε το πρώτο γράμμα του κρυπτογράφου μας, το οποίο είναι” Δ.”Στη συνέχεια, τα δεύτερα γράμματα των κλειδιών και των λέξεων των αρχείων μας είναι” o “και” t “αντίστοιχα. Διεξάγονται στο “h.”Θα συνεχίσετε αυτό μέχρι να ολοκληρώσετε και τα έξι γράμματα.

Μήνυμα απλού κείμενο: ΕΠΙΘΕΣΗ
Κλειδί: Σκυλί
Κρυπτογράφημα: Dhzdqq

Cryptanalysis: Cracking a Vigenère Cipher

Λόγω της χρήσης ενός κλειδιού, ο κρυπτογραφικός κρυπτογράφηση του Vigenère δεν μπορεί αρχικά να σπάσει χρησιμοποιώντας μια απλή ανάλυση συχνότητας όπως θα μπορούσατε να κάνετε με έναν Cipher Caesar. Αν και, η κύρια αδυναμία ενός κρυπτογράφου Vigenère είναι η επανάληψη του κλειδιού. Έτσι, στο παράδειγμά μας, το “σκυλί” επαναλήφθηκε δύο φορές για να ταιριάζει με τον αριθμό των γραμμάτων στη λέξη “επίθεση.”Εάν ένας εισβολέας μαντέψει το μήκος του κλειδιού, γίνεται πολύ πιο εύκολο να σπάσει. Το κρυπτογράφημα στη συνέχεια αντιμετωπίζεται σαν μια σειρά μικρών κρυπτογράφων Caesar και μια μέθοδος όπως η ανάλυση συχνότητας θα μπορούσε στη συνέχεια να πραγματοποιηθεί για να σπάσει τον κώδικα.

  Façons d'être en sécurité sur Internet

Αλλά πώς μπορεί ένας εισβολέας να μαντέψει το μήκος του κλειδιού? Υπάρχουν στην πραγματικότητα δύο μέθοδοι: η εξέταση Kasiski και η δοκιμή Friedman. Εάν ο εισβολέας παρατηρεί ότι υπάρχουν επαναλαμβανόμενα τμήματα κειμένου στο κρυπτογράφημα, μια εξέταση Kasiski θα ήταν αποτελεσματική στη διάσπαση του κώδικα. Ο επιτιθέμενος θα μετρούσε την απόσταση των γραμμάτων μεταξύ του επαναλαμβανόμενου κειμένου για να πάρει μια καλή ιδέα για το πόσο καιρό είναι το κλειδί. Η δοκιμή Friedman λαμβάνει μια αλγεβρική προσέγγιση χρησιμοποιώντας έναν τύπο για τη μέτρηση της ανομοιομορφίας των συχνοτήτων επιστολών κρυπτογράφησης για να σπάσει τον κρυπτογράφημα. Όσο περισσότερο είναι το κείμενο, τόσο πιο ακριβής είναι αυτή η τεχνική

Ερχόμενοι: Ciphers του 20ού αιώνα

Το κουτί του Καίσαρα και ο κρυπτογράφος Vigenère είναι δύο από τους πρώτους γνωστούς κρυπτογράφους. Πρωτοστάτησαν στη χρήση κρυπτογράφησης για την προστασία των ευαίσθητων δεδομένων επικοινωνιών και τη χρήση μυστικού κλειδιού στην κρυπτογράφηση. Στην επόμενη θέση σε αυτή τη σειρά, θα προχωρήσουμε στον 20ό αιώνα. Θα δούμε πώς εξελίχθηκε η κρυπτογραφία όταν οδηγείται τόσο από στρατιωτικά συμφέροντα όσο και από οργανώσεις που προστατεύουν την πνευματική τους ιδιοκτησία

Ghostvolt Solo

Rock Solid αρχείου κρυπτογράφηση για όλους

• Προστατέψτε την κλοπή δεδομένων
• Κλειδώστε εύκολα οποιοδήποτε αρχείο
• Αυτοματοποιημένη κρυπτογράφηση
• Ασφαλής κοινή χρήση αρχείων
• Ετικέτα αρχείου
• Σούπερ εύκολο στη χρήση

Προέλευση της κρυπτογραφίας

Ο άνθρωπος από ηλικίες είχε δύο εγγενείς ανάγκες – (α) να επικοινωνεί και να μοιράζεται πληροφορίες και (β) να επικοινωνήσει επιλεκτικά. Αυτές οι δύο ανάγκες δημιούργησαν την τέχνη της κωδικοποίησης των μηνυμάτων με τέτοιο τρόπο ώστε μόνο οι επιδιωκόμενοι άνθρωποι να έχουν πρόσβαση στις πληροφορίες. Οι μη εξουσιοδοτημένοι άνθρωποι δεν μπορούσαν να εξαγάγουν καμία πληροφορία, ακόμη και αν τα κωδικοποιημένα μηνύματα έπεσαν στο χέρι τους.

Η τέχνη και η επιστήμη της απόκρυψης των μηνυμάτων για την εισαγωγή της μυστικότητας στην ασφάλεια των πληροφοριών αναγνωρίζεται ως κρυπτογραφία.

Η λέξη «κρυπτογραφία» δημιουργήθηκε συνδυάζοντας δύο ελληνικά λόγια, «krypto» που σημαίνει κρυμμένο και «graphene» που σημαίνει γραφή.

Ιστορία της κρυπτογραφίας

Η τέχνη της κρυπτογραφίας θεωρείται ότι γεννήθηκε μαζί με την τέχνη της γραφής. Καθώς οι πολιτισμοί εξελίχθηκαν, τα ανθρώπινα όντα διοργανώθηκαν σε φυλές, ομάδες και βασίλεια. Αυτό οδήγησε στην εμφάνιση ιδεών όπως η εξουσία, οι μάχες, η υπεροχή και η πολιτική. Αυτές οι ιδέες τροφοδότησαν περαιτέρω τη φυσική ανάγκη των ανθρώπων να επικοινωνούν κρυφά με επιλεκτικό παραλήπτη, ο οποίος με τη σειρά του εξασφάλισε τη συνεχή εξέλιξη της κρυπτογραφίας επίσης.

Οι ρίζες της κρυπτογραφίας βρίσκονται σε ρωμαϊκούς και αιγυπτιακούς πολιτισμούς.

  VPN sans stratégie de journaux

Ιερογλυφικός – η παλαιότερη κρυπτογραφική τεχνική

Τα πρώτα γνωστά στοιχεία της κρυπτογραφίας μπορούν να ανιχνευθούν στη χρήση του «ιερογλυφικού». Πριν από περίπου 4000 χρόνια, οι Αιγύπτιοι χρησιμοποίησαν για να επικοινωνούν με μηνύματα γραμμένα σε ιερογλυφικό. Αυτός ο κώδικας ήταν το μυστικό γνωστό μόνο στους γραμματείς που χρησιμοποιούσαν μηνύματα για λογαριασμό των βασιλιάδων. Ένα τέτοιο ιερογλυφικό παρουσιάζεται παρακάτω.

Ιερογλυφικός

Αργότερα, οι μελετητές προχώρησαν στη χρήση απλών μονο-αλφαβητικών κρυπτογράφων υποκατάστασης κατά τη διάρκεια 500 έως 600 π.Χ. Αυτό περιλάμβανε την αντικατάσταση αλφαβήτων μηνυμάτων με άλλα αλφάβητα με κάποιο μυστικό κανόνα. Αυτό κανόνας έγινε ένα κλειδί Για να ανακτήσετε το μήνυμα από το αλλοιωμένο μήνυμα.

Η προηγούμενη ρωμαϊκή μέθοδος κρυπτογραφίας, δημοφιλής γνωστή ως Caesar Shift Cipher, βασίζεται στη μετατόπιση των επιστολών ενός μηνύματος με έναν συμφωνημένο αριθμό (τρεις ήταν μια κοινή επιλογή), ο παραλήπτης αυτού του μηνύματος θα μετατοπίσει τα γράμματα πίσω με τον ίδιο αριθμό και θα λάβει το αρχικό μήνυμα.

Caesar Shift Cipher

Στεγανογραφία

Η Steganography είναι παρόμοια, αλλά προσθέτει μια άλλη διάσταση στην κρυπτογραφία. Σε αυτή τη μέθοδο, οι άνθρωποι όχι μόνο θέλουν να προστατεύσουν τη μυστικότητα μιας πληροφορίας, αποκρύπτοντας την, αλλά θέλουν επίσης να βεβαιωθούν ότι οποιοδήποτε μη εξουσιοδοτημένο άτομο δεν έχει αποδείξεις ότι οι πληροφορίες υπάρχουν ακόμη και. Για παράδειγμα, αόρατος υδατογράφημα.

Στη Steganography, ένας ακούσιος παραλήπτης ή ένας εισβολέας δεν γνωρίζει το γεγονός ότι τα παρατηρούμενα δεδομένα περιέχουν κρυφές πληροφορίες. Στην κρυπτογραφία, ένας εισβολέας συνήθως γνωρίζει ότι τα δεδομένα κοινοποιούνται, επειδή μπορούν να δουν το κωδικοποιημένο/κωδικοποιημένο μήνυμα.

Στεγανογραφία

Εξέλιξη της κρυπτογραφίας

Κατά τη διάρκεια και μετά την ευρωπαϊκή Αναγέννηση, διάφορα ιταλικά και παπικά κράτη οδήγησαν τον ταχέως πολλαπλασιασμό κρυπτογραφικών τεχνικών. Διάφορες τεχνικές ανάλυσης και επίθεσης ερευνήθηκαν σε αυτή την εποχή για να σπάσουν τους μυστικούς κώδικες.

  • Βελτιωμένες τεχνικές κωδικοποίησης όπως Κωδικοποίηση vigenere δημιουργήθηκε στον 15ο αιώνα, η οποία προσέφερε κινούμενα γράμματα στο μήνυμα με μια σειρά μεταβλητών θέσεων αντί να τους μετακινήσει τον ίδιο αριθμό θέσεων.
  • Μόνο μετά τον 19ο αιώνα, η κρυπτογραφία εξελίχθηκε από τις ad hoc προσεγγίσεις στην κρυπτογράφηση στην πιο εξελιγμένη τέχνη και επιστήμη της ασφάλειας των πληροφοριών.
  • Στις αρχές του 20ου αιώνα, η εφεύρεση μηχανικών και ηλεκτρομηχανικών μηχανών, όπως το Μηχανή ρότορα αίνιγμα, παρείχε πιο προηγμένα και αποτελεσματικά μέσα κωδικοποίησης των πληροφοριών.
  • Κατά την περίοδο του Β ‘Παγκοσμίου Πολέμου, και οι δύο κρυπτογράφηση και κρυπτοεξίληψη έγινε υπερβολικά μαθηματικός.

Με τις προόδους που λαμβάνουν χώρα στον τομέα αυτό, οι κυβερνητικές οργανώσεις, οι στρατιωτικές μονάδες και ορισμένα εταιρικά σπίτια άρχισαν να υιοθετούν τις εφαρμογές κρυπτογραφίας. Χρησιμοποίησαν κρυπτογραφία για να φυλάξουν τα μυστικά τους από άλλους. Τώρα, η άφιξη των υπολογιστών και του Διαδικτύου έχει φέρει αποτελεσματική κρυπτογραφία σε απόσταση κοινών ανθρώπων.

Kickstart Η καριέρα σας

Πιστοποιήστε συμπληρώνοντας το μάθημα